UFC Fight Night 151
Al Iaquinta (14-4-1) vs. Donald Cerrone (35-11)
Our beloved "Long Island Idiot" has won 5 of his last 6 with the lone loss being a decent effort to champ Khabib Nurmagomedov. Al is solid as they come and one of the greatest interviews in the game today.
"Cowboy" has proven he ain't ready to be put out to pasture just yet. Cerrone is a new father and reborn in MMA. Okay, maybe not, but he's always a fun watch even if he can't take punishment anymore. Donnie is talented everywhere but he has had 48 professional fights so, ya know.
We like "Ragin' Al" to do enough work to win 3 rounds at the least in what should be "Fight of the Weekend!"
WINNER-Al Iaquinta by Decision

Kevin Swanson (25-10) vs. Shane Burgos (11-1)
Geez, we don't like to see "Cub" go down like this after all the great years of MMA he gave us. Swanson has lost his last 3 but more than that, dude is now 35 and has been through a lot of wars. Burgos meanwhile is on the come up and boasting a healthy 4-1 UFC record.
It's just too much at this point. Much like Ross Pearson recently, ya gotta know when to go.
WINNER-Shane Burgos by Decision

Brent Primus (8-1) vs. Tim Wilde (12-3)
Primus lost his belt last out to Michael Chandler, but gained a lot of respect in the effort. "The Experiment" is coming in from England on a 3-fight bounce and has a nice opportunity here. Ya gotta favor the American to hold the homeland in a fun fight.
WINNER-Brent Primus by Decision
